I put the wrong number for my property taxes and can't seem to get back to that number to change it.

There are two places to enter property tax. There is a box on the Form 1098 for property tax and there is a section to enter just the property tax. 

 

To go to the Property tax entry:

While signed in and working in TurboTax Online,

  • Click on Federal in the black left-hand menu.
  • Click on Deductions and Credits
  • Scroll down and click on Show More under Your Home.
  • Choose Start or Revisit under Property (Real Estate) Taxes.

To go to the Form 1098, Mortgage Interest, section:

 

While signed in and working in TurboTax Online,

  • Click on Federal in the black left-hand menu.
  • Click on Deductions and Credits
  • Scroll down and click on Show More under Your Home.
  • Choose Start or Revisit under Mortgage Interest and Refinancing.
